The Amsterdam Admirals were a Dutch American football - team , that of 1995 bis 2007 in the NFL Europe played. Home stadium was the Amsterdam Arena . In the 2007 season, the team returned to the Amsterdam Olympic Stadium for a game that the Admirals had played for one season in 1995 before moving to the Amsterdam ArenA.
For the first time since the league's start-up season in 1995, Amsterdam reached the World Bowl finals on June 11, 2005 . In contrast to the game against Frankfurt Galaxy at the time , Amsterdam won the final against Berlin Thunder in the LTU arena in Düsseldorf this time . In 2006 the Admirals reached the World Bowl again, but lost clearly against Frankfurt Galaxy with 7:22.
